Install Maya on Linux using the rpm utility
With the rpm command line utility, you can use either the -i flag or the -ivh
flag to install the programs. The -ivh flag provides you with more information
during the installation.
To install Maya on Linux using the rpm utility
1 Open a shell as a super user (using su -).
2 Do one of the following:
Insert the Maya DVD into your drive and mount the DVD drive. For
example, type: mount -r /dev/dvd /mnt/dvd.
Extract the Maya packages from the compressed file you downloaded,
then change to the directory where you extracted the Maya packages.
3 Use the ls command to list the packages.
The packages you see will be similar to the following, where # indicates
the specific package numbers.
